SEA Empowerment Scheme: Farmers Receive Farming Facilities, Urged to Tackle Food Security

Over 100 participants, after undergoing professional training, under the SEA Empowerment Scheme, received certificates and farming equipment, including spray cans, various types of fertilizers, herbicides, fungicides, and funds to enhance their farming processes.

The training and empowerment programme was organized by Honorable Sanni Egidi Abdulraheem, Representative of Ajaokuta Federal Constituency, in collaboration with the National Centre for Technology Management (NACETEM), successfully concluded.

The programme, held at the traditional council chamber in Adogo, the headquarters of Ajaokuta, aimed to equip farmers with techniques in farming, fertilizer application, and machine usage.

Comrade. Ahmed A. Momohjimoh, Senior Legislative Aide, praised Honorable Sanni Egidi Abdulraheem for initiating the program, which has created self-employment opportunities in the constituency.

Honorable Sanni Abdulraheem, represented by his legislative aide, encouraged participants to view the training as a means of achieving economic independence. He emphasized the need for food security and urged farmers to implement the training and utilize the provided facilities judiciously.

The Ajaokuta Federal Lawmaker promised to provide gigantic machines and professional operators, which farmers cannot afford in their micro-farming processes, to enable farmers to expand their farm activities in Ajaokuta LGA.

Yakubu Omuya Ahmed, speaking on behalf of the beneficiaries, appreciated the lawmaker’s transparency and accountability in utilizing constituency funds for empowerment programs. They commended Hon. SEA for fulfilling his campaign promises since assuming office.

The event was attended by representatives from the Federal Ministry of Special Duties and Intergovernmental Affairs, Mrs. Florence Okiji, Nigerian Institute of Mining and Geosciences, Jos, Engr. Abel A Joshua, Murtadho Husseinat, and Yahaya Zuleihat, representing Rad Bird Consultancy LTD, Facilitator Latifat Asipita Isah, Agronomist Ms. Rafat Onize Abdul.
